This is stain remover, … Web5 nov. 2024 · Step 3: Remove the ice pack and scrape the remaining chocolate as in Step 1. Step 4: Put some dish soap on a damp sponge, and use it to blot the stain until youve gotten as much out as possible. Step 5: Rinse the sponge and blot again to remove any soap left on the stain. Step 6: Pat dry with a clean, dry white towel .

Web21 nov. 2024 · Here’s how to get chocolate milk stains out of a rug: 1. Blot the stain with a clean, dry cloth. 2. Apply a small amount of liquid dish soap to the stain and work it in with your fingers. 3. Rinse the area with warm water. 4. Repeat steps 2-3 until the stain is gone. 5. Vacuum the area to remove any soap residue. Web26 feb. 2024 · 2.Use cold, not hot water to remove chocolate stains. 3. Make a chocolate stain remover. 4. Web6 dec. 2024 · To make a cleaning solution, combine a teaspoon of clear ammonia and a cup of warm water. Set the stain for five minutes on hot chocolate with this solution. Always test ammonia on an inconspicuous area of carpet first, never mix ammonia with any other chemical, and never spray ammonia on clothing.
